Vodafone provides a Rs 239 prepaid package that delivers 1GB of daily data. The prepaid gives 1ooSMS per day and true unlimited calling. The package has a duration of 24 days only. The prepaid package does not come with extra perks like a free membership to Vi Movies, Disney+ Hotstar, and many others.

If you require a longer-term validity plan, there is a Rs 269 prepaid plan that includes 1GB of data per day, 100 SMS per day, and unlimited calling. The 269 prepaid plan has a duration of 28 days. It gives a complimentary subscription to the Rs 239 prepaid plan, which only has a period of 24 days and does not offer any further advantages.

If you want extra data per day, a Rs 249 package is available. The prepaid plan provides daily data advantages of 1.5 GB. It provides 100 SMS each day as well as unlimited calling. The prepaid plan, on the other hand, has a 21-day duration. The prepaid package also includes a free Vi Movies subscription.

Another option is available for Rs 219 per month. The prepaid plan includes daily data advantages of 1GB per day, 100 SMS per day, and true unlimited calling. The prepaid plan has a validity period of 21 days. The prepaid package also includes a free Vi Movies subscription.

There’s a plan for Rs 299. The prepaid plan includes daily internet benefits of 1.5 GB per day, 100 SMS per day, and unlimited calling. The prepaid plan has a 28-day validity period. 

The best feature about such a plan is the Binge all-night option, which allows users to browse, watch, and share as much as they want from 12 a.m. to 6 a.m. without any pack deductions. It also includes free weekend data rollover & up to 2GB of backup data each month. The prepaid package also includes a free Vi Movies subscription.
